我有一个没有标题字段的自定义帖子类型。这些是简短的状态消息,其中只有内容重要。RSS提要和permalink将标题显示为自动草稿,这不是很有用。理想情况下,它应该有帖子内容,或者至少有前10个左右的单词。
我尝试了此功能,但它仍然显示为自动拔模:
add_filter(\'title_save_pre\', \'save_title\');
function save_title($my_post_title) {
if ($_POST[\'post_type\'] == \'servicestatus\') :
$new_title = wp_trim_words( $_POST[\'content\'], $num_words = 10, $more = null )
$my_post_title = $new_title;
endif;
return $my_post_title;
}
add_filter(\'name_save_pre\', \'save_name\');
function save_name($my_post_name) {
if ($_POST[\'post_type\'] == \'servicestatus\') :
$new_name = wp_trim_words( $_POST[\'content\'], $num_words = 10, $more = null )
$my_post_name = $new_name;
endif;
return $my_post_name;
}